Police appeal after Man is stabbed in Carshalton

Police in Sutton are appealing for information and witnesses following a stabbing in Carshalton. Officers and London Ambulance Service were called to Wrythe Lane, SM5 at 4.30am on Monday, 28 May following reports of a stabbing. Both attended and found a man in his forties suffering from stab injuries. He has been taken to a south London hospital where he remains in a stable condition. It is believed that the stabbing took place at the property following a meeting with the suspect. The suspect is described as a black male aged 20-30 of medium build with short black hair. No arrests have been made. Enquiries continue. Anyone with information is requested to call police on 101 quoting CAD 1329/29May or Crimestoppers anonymously on 0800 555 111.
